新聞中心

EEPW首頁(yè) >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> 基于單片機(jī)的電池供電設(shè)備的微功耗設(shè)計(jì)策略淺析

基于單片機(jī)的電池供電設(shè)備的微功耗設(shè)計(jì)策略淺析

作者: 時(shí)間:2013-03-14 來(lái)源:網(wǎng)絡(luò) 收藏
基于的電池供設(shè)備設(shè)計(jì)中,芯片的工作電壓、頻率設(shè)置、工作模式設(shè)置都將影響系統(tǒng)的整體功耗,此外,減少外圍電路以及合理的外圍電路設(shè)計(jì)也是影響功耗的關(guān)鍵因素。本文結(jié)合在便攜儀表的設(shè)計(jì)闡述了低功耗設(shè)計(jì)的選擇策略和外圍電路設(shè)計(jì)思路。

  在預(yù)付費(fèi)式水表、氣表、熱表、數(shù)字流量計(jì)等應(yīng)用中,一般采用電池供電。合理地設(shè)計(jì)這些單片機(jī)系統(tǒng),可以在不換電池的情況下,能連續(xù)工作數(shù)年時(shí)間。要滿足這些要求必須在設(shè)計(jì)中解決好單片機(jī)系統(tǒng)的問(wèn)題,必須從單片機(jī)的選擇、單片機(jī)的設(shè)計(jì)與使用、外部電路的設(shè)計(jì)以及電源供電方面綜合考慮。

  對(duì)于大部分單片機(jī)系統(tǒng),由于單片機(jī)的運(yùn)行速度很快,單片機(jī)在工作的過(guò)程中有大量的空閑等待時(shí)間。在某些情況下,系統(tǒng)的等待時(shí)間甚至可以達(dá)到總工作時(shí)間的95%以上。在等待過(guò)程中,單片機(jī)不作任何工作,只是在踏步等待,或者在循環(huán)判斷有無(wú)新的外部請(qǐng)求。在這個(gè)過(guò)程中,可以讓單片機(jī)內(nèi)部的大部分電路工作在休眠狀態(tài),可以大大地降低單片機(jī)的功耗。同時(shí),也可以讓有關(guān)的外部電路工作在休眠狀態(tài),這樣就使整個(gè)產(chǎn)品的供電大大降低。產(chǎn)品的這種非連續(xù)工作的特點(diǎn)是設(shè)計(jì)的基本思路,此外,還要根據(jù)產(chǎn)品的特點(diǎn)醉意更多的設(shè)計(jì)細(xì)節(jié)。

  選擇合適的CPU芯片是設(shè)計(jì)的關(guān)鍵

  目前的單片機(jī)種類很多,而且大都針對(duì)某一個(gè)特定的應(yīng)用,可根據(jù)具體應(yīng)用情況選擇合適的單片機(jī)。在需要進(jìn)行微功耗設(shè)計(jì)的應(yīng)用中,可以根據(jù)下面的規(guī)則來(lái)選擇:

  1. 選擇盡可能減少外部電路的單片機(jī)。隨著集成電路工藝技術(shù)的飛速發(fā)展,真正單片化的單片機(jī)系統(tǒng)已逐步成為主流產(chǎn)品。

  2. 注意比較工作電流和靜態(tài)電流。由于工藝的不同,單片機(jī)內(nèi)部工作電流、靜態(tài)電流不盡相同,有的甚至相差很大。在選擇單片機(jī)時(shí),不但要考慮其工作電流,還要仔細(xì)考慮其在休眠狀態(tài)下的靜態(tài)電流。

  3. 通過(guò)比較可以看出,選用專用的低功耗單片機(jī),可更加靈活地控制其功耗,在滿足設(shè)計(jì)要求的前提下使其盡可能工作于最省電的模式。

  4. 選擇合適的ROM、RAM。一般來(lái)講,存儲(chǔ)器越大功耗也越大。在滿足設(shè)計(jì)要求的情況下,盡可能使用單片機(jī)內(nèi)部的ROM、RAM。

  5. 選擇合適的工作時(shí)鐘頻率。在較低的時(shí)鐘頻率下,單片機(jī)的功耗也較低。以MSP430F1121為例,當(dāng)工作在1MHz的主頻之下,典型電流消耗為300uA;而工作在4096Hz的主頻之下,其電流只有3uA。

  6. 選擇合適的IO管腳數(shù),和合適的IO驅(qū)動(dòng)能力和顯示驅(qū)動(dòng)能力。單片機(jī)驅(qū)動(dòng)的IO管腳數(shù)越多,其功耗也就越大。

  7. 選擇合適的單片機(jī),實(shí)現(xiàn)真正意義上單片化,可以省去了大量的硬件開(kāi)發(fā)調(diào)試工作,提高了工作效率,系統(tǒng)的可靠性、抗干擾能力得到了顯著的改善,同時(shí)使系統(tǒng)成本降低,更加適合微型化和便攜化,對(duì)降低系統(tǒng)功耗有著決定性的作用。

  低功耗設(shè)計(jì)策略

  a. 使內(nèi)部電路可選擇性地工作

  一般,設(shè)計(jì)中不會(huì)用到全部的單片機(jī)內(nèi)部電路,而那些沒(méi)有用到的電路將產(chǎn)生額外的功耗。在需要進(jìn)行微功耗設(shè)計(jì)的應(yīng)用中,可以通過(guò)對(duì)內(nèi)部特殊功能寄存器編程,選擇使用不同的功能模塊,對(duì)于不使用的功能模塊使其停止工作,減少系統(tǒng)無(wú)效功耗。

  b. 產(chǎn)品的低電壓設(shè)計(jì)可以降低產(chǎn)品功耗

  一般,單片機(jī)的工作電壓越高,內(nèi)部晶體管在放大區(qū)的工作時(shí)間也越長(zhǎng),單片機(jī)的功耗也就越大。由于采用先進(jìn)的芯片生產(chǎn)工藝,使單片機(jī)的電壓范圍一般很寬,如可以在1.8V~5V電源電壓范圍內(nèi)正常工作。為了降低系統(tǒng)功耗,可盡量采用低電壓設(shè)計(jì)。

  單片機(jī)供電電壓范圍的放寬,可以進(jìn)一步拓寬單片機(jī)的應(yīng)用領(lǐng)域,尤其是便攜式或掌上型設(shè)備中,可以放心地使用電池作為電源,而不必關(guān)心放電過(guò)程電壓曲線是否平衡、在低電壓下是否會(huì)影響單片機(jī)正常工作,更不必因電池供電而專門增加穩(wěn)壓電路,從而可減少大量的功率消耗。

  c. 在空閑狀態(tài)時(shí),采用低速時(shí)鐘信號(hào)

  單片機(jī)的功耗與其工作頻率成正比,系統(tǒng)運(yùn)行頻率越高,電源功耗就會(huì)相應(yīng)增大。圖1所示為Philips公司的80C31單片機(jī)Vcc上的電流與主時(shí)鐘頻率的關(guān)系曲線,可以看出隨著單片機(jī)主時(shí)鐘頻率的增加,其Vcc上的電流也呈線形增加,則其功耗也隨著主時(shí)鐘頻率的增加而增加。


上一頁(yè) 1 2 下一頁(yè)

評(píng)論


相關(guān)推薦

技術(shù)專區(qū)

關(guān)閉